Specific role of N-methyl-D-aspartate (NMDA) receptor in elastin-derived VGVAPG peptide-dependent calcium homeostasis in mouse cortical astrocytes in vitro

Under physiological and pathological conditions, elastin is degraded to produce elastin-derived peptides (EDPs).
